bool XmlRpcServerConnection::executeMulticall ( const std::string methodName,
XmlRpcValue params,
XmlRpcValue result 
) [protected]

Definition at line 272 of file XmlRpcServerConnection.cpp.

References executeMethod(), FAULTCODE, FAULTSTRING, XmlRpc::XmlRpcException::getCode(), XmlRpc::XmlRpcException::getMessage(), XmlRpc::XmlRpcValue::getType(), genRecEmupikp::i, METHODNAME, PARAMS, XmlRpc::XmlRpcValue::setSize(), XmlRpc::XmlRpcValue::size(), deljobs::string, SYSTEM_MULTICALL, and XmlRpc::XmlRpcValue::TypeArray.

Referenced by executeRequest().

00274 {
00275   if (methodName != SYSTEM_MULTICALL) return false;
00276 
00277   // There ought to be 1 parameter, an array of structs
00278   if (params.size() != 1 || params[0].getType() != XmlRpcValue::TypeArray)
00279     throw XmlRpcException(SYSTEM_MULTICALL + ": Invalid argument (expected an array)");
00280 
00281   int nc = params[0].size();
00282   result.setSize(nc);
00283 
00284   for (int i=0; i<nc; ++i) {
00285 
00286     if ( ! params[0][i].hasMember(METHODNAME) ||
00287          ! params[0][i].hasMember(PARAMS)) {
00288       result[i][FAULTCODE] = -1;
00289       result[i][FAULTSTRING] = SYSTEM_MULTICALL +
00290               ": Invalid argument (expected a struct with members methodName and params)";
00291       continue;
00292     }
00293 
00294     const std::string& methodName = params[0][i][METHODNAME];
00295     XmlRpcValue& methodParams = params[0][i][PARAMS];
00296 
00297     XmlRpcValue resultValue;
00298     resultValue.setSize(1);
00299     try {
00300       if ( ! executeMethod(methodName, methodParams, resultValue[0]) &&
00301            ! executeMulticall(methodName, params, resultValue[0]))
00302       {
00303         result[i][FAULTCODE] = -1;
00304         result[i][FAULTSTRING] = methodName + ": unknown method name";
00305       }
00306       else
00307         result[i] = resultValue;
00308 
00309     } catch (const XmlRpcException& fault) {
00310         result[i][FAULTCODE] = fault.getCode();
00311         result[i][FAULTSTRING] = fault.getMessage();
00312     }
00313   }
00314 
00315   return true;
00316 }

bool XmlRpcServerConnection::readHeader (  )  [protected]

Definition at line 69 of file XmlRpcServerConnection.cpp.

References _connectionState, _contentLength, _header, _keepAlive, _request, EvtCyclic3::c_str(), ers::error, XmlRpc::XmlRpcUtil::error(), XmlRpc::XmlRpcSocket::getErrorMsg(), XmlRpc::XmlRpcUtil::log(), XmlRpc::XmlRpcSocket::nbRead(), RealDBUtil::npos, and READ_REQUEST.

Referenced by handleEvent().

00070 {
00071   // Read available data
00072   bool eof;
00073   if ( ! XmlRpcSocket::nbRead(this->getfd(), _header, &eof)) {
00074     // Its only an error if we already have read some data
00075     if (_header.length() > 0)
00076       XmlRpcUtil::error("XmlRpcServerConnection::readHeader: error while reading header (%s).",XmlRpcSocket::getErrorMsg().c_str());
00077     return false;
00078   }
00079 
00080   XmlRpcUtil::log(4, "XmlRpcServerConnection::readHeader: read %d bytes.", _header.length());
00081   char *hp = (char*)_header.c_str();  // Start of header
00082   char *ep = hp + _header.length();   // End of string
00083   char *bp = 0;                       // Start of body
00084   char *lp = 0;                       // Start of content-length value
00085   char *kp = 0;                       // Start of connection value
00086 
00087   for (char *cp = hp; (bp == 0) && (cp < ep); ++cp) {
00088         if ((ep - cp > 16) && (strncasecmp(cp, "Content-length: ", 16) == 0))
00089           lp = cp + 16;
00090         else if ((ep - cp > 12) && (strncasecmp(cp, "Connection: ", 12) == 0))
00091           kp = cp + 12;
00092         else if ((ep - cp > 4) && (strncmp(cp, "\r\n\r\n", 4) == 0))
00093           bp = cp + 4;
00094         else if ((ep - cp > 2) && (strncmp(cp, "\n\n", 2) == 0))
00095           bp = cp + 2;
00096   }
00097 
00098   // If we haven't gotten the entire header yet, return (keep reading)
00099   if (bp == 0) {
00100     // EOF in the middle of a request is an error, otherwise its ok
00101     if (eof) {
00102       XmlRpcUtil::log(4, "XmlRpcServerConnection::readHeader: EOF");
00103       if (_header.length() > 0)
00104         XmlRpcUtil::error("XmlRpcServerConnection::readHeader: EOF while reading header");
00105       return false;   // Either way we close the connection
00106     }
00107     
00108     return true;  // Keep reading
00109   }
00110 
00111   // Decode content length
00112   if (lp == 0) {
00113     XmlRpcUtil::error("XmlRpcServerConnection::readHeader: No Content-length specified");
00114     return false;   // We could try to figure it out by parsing as we read, but for now...
00115   }
00116 
00117   _contentLength = atoi(lp);
00118   if (_contentLength <= 0) {
00119     XmlRpcUtil::error("XmlRpcServerConnection::readHeader: Invalid Content-length specified (%d).", _contentLength);
00120     return false;
00121   }
00122         
00123   XmlRpcUtil::log(3, "XmlRpcServerConnection::readHeader: specified content length is %d.", _contentLength);
00124 
00125   // Otherwise copy non-header data to request buffer and set state to read request.
00126   _request = bp;
00127 
00128   // Parse out any interesting bits from the header (HTTP version, connection)
00129   _keepAlive = true;
00130   if (_header.find("HTTP/1.0") != std::string::npos) {
00131     if (kp == 0 || strncasecmp(kp, "keep-alive", 10) != 0)
00132       _keepAlive = false;           // Default for HTTP 1.0 is to close the connection
00133   } else {
00134     if (kp != 0 && strncasecmp(kp, "close", 5) == 0)
00135       _keepAlive = false;
00136   }
00137   XmlRpcUtil::log(3, "KeepAlive: %d", _keepAlive);
00138 
00139 
00140   _header = ""; 
00141   _connectionState = READ_REQUEST;
00142   return true;    // Continue monitoring this source
00143 }
